Nope, I'm referring to the main cfg files. I have setup Opsview in Solaris 10, but I'm getting this error: NRPE: Command 'check_memory' not defined on the local host. I have edited services.cfg and changed the command to be check_memory_solaris for the default one does not work and I've added a new service check as well and restarted opswiev and opsview-agent and nothing happens. I've also tried to add a new host to be monitored but it doesn't appear on the web. Do I need to edit the config files of Opsview or do I specify to use the Nagios cfg files within /usr/local/nagios/etc/objects? The url <ipadress>/nagvis refuses to open. Instead of the webpage i see a dialogue box which asks me to select a program to open de index.php. If i go to the url <ipadress>/nagvis/wui, everything works normal. If i use the right mouse button i can can open my maps in nagvis. On that page i can select all my maps in the dropdown menu, except Overview and Automap. Until opsview 3.0.3 i had no problem. Has someone an idea?
